Output ca3913107d486947da406e16d6a3c20594730fcd7e4071e355b90ad15c21d2e7:1

value
536090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725a46aa24563ad35afeffc4bc18c5e17707f1a8 OP_EQUAL
address
3C7f6uDuTkCqB9VNP4Vnk2marSJbxKrbmh
transaction
ca3913107d486947da406e16d6a3c20594730fcd7e4071e355b90ad15c21d2e7
confirmations
492128
spent
true